Synkinesis Following Recurrent Laryngeal Nerve Injury: A Computer Simulation
OBJECTIVES: When the recurrent laryngeal nerve (RLN) is injured, functional recovery may be limited by the number of axons that regrow across the site of injury, and by the proportions of these axons that reinnervate the antagonistic muscle (synkinesis).
